from www.dictionary.com: dod·der (intr.v.)
- To shake or tremble, as from old age; totter
- To progress in a feeble, unsteady manner.
dod'der·er (n.) - one who dodders
Presidents Trophy 2011
Played for annually on the nearest Sunday to our President's birthday (19th April) the 2011 contest took place on Sunday 17th. This year saw combined teams battle for the Corin sculpture - with last year's runaway winners The Valleys (East) combiniing with the Heartlands (South). Up against them were the 2010 last placed Vale (West) who combined with the City (North).
The N/W emerged winners - soundly beating the S/E despite them having both Jordi and Nat!
